Default Wrong Batteries???

I just bout a 93 36volt club car with a bad motor. The last owner had it as a project and put new batteries in it and never got it running. I did fix the motor (broken coil) and charged it up and ran it last night with mediocre results. The batteries never got to over 6.1 volts each except one that got to 6.2v and one got to 6.5v. The batteries have "8 B Y" stamped on the positive terminal and "4" stamped on the negative. The plastic tops have "A31N" stamped in them. There is no brand name or any other markings, they are black with no stickers.

Did I get screwed?

Default Re: Wrong Batteries???

Generally battery manufacturers use FIRST a letter for the month and SECOND a number for the year.....some do it differently than others so without knowing who made them it's just an educated guess. Like 4 would be 2004 but you dont have a letter in front so.....


A31N....Jan, 2003 should be when they were shipped and the other 2 are WHERE they were built. Thats in the top of the case. It can't be 2013 so.....
(shipped date does NOT mean when they were filled) Filled would likely be 04.
Might double check those numbers too. The first set doesn't make any sense at all. Maybe someone else will chime in.
